Default *** 2.5" or 3" DP ??? ***

I am planning to run a turbo LS/Vtec with pistons and rods (not sleeved) and hope for 350-400whp with Hondata.

SC34 turbo
Spearco FMIC
Hondata S200B
RC 550s
BLOX Mani

I was planning to run a 3" AC compliant DP with 3" cat and exhaust. But I was recently told that a 2.5" would make about the same power and that I would reach full boost sooner and that it would have more low end. And that would be better for take offs as its a daily driver.

Agree or no?
